During pregnancy and lactation these glands, also called Montgomery's glands, become enlarged.[26]. Sebaceous glands of the breast are also known as Montgomery's glands. Meibomian glands, in the eyelids, secrete a form of sebum called meibum onto the eye, that slows the evaporation of tears.
